The UPSC Engineering Services (ESE) Mains Result 2026 has been officially declared by the Union Public Service Commission (UPSC) on 24 July 2026. Candidates who appeared in the Engineering Services (Main) Examination 2026 held on 21 June 2026 can now download the result PDF from the official UPSC website.
The Mains Result contains the roll numbers of shortlisted candidates who have qualified for the next stage of the recruitment process, i.e., the Personality Test (Interview). Candidates are advised to check the official notification carefully for interview schedules and document verification instructions.

Selection Process
The UPSC Engineering Services recruitment consists of:
- Preliminary Examination
- Main Examination
- Personality Test (Interview)
- Medical Examination
- Final Merit List
